There's no place like home for Cedarville,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Tuesday. Their pitcher stepped up to hand the Fairbanks Panthers a 2-0 shutout on Wednesday. The victory was a breath of fresh air for the Indians as it put an end to their three-game losing streak.

Tavin Baldwin was a major factor while hitting and pitching. On the mound, he didn't allow a single earned run over seven innings pitched. Baldwin was also big at the plate, scoring a run and stealing two bases while going 1-for-2. He is becoming a predictor of Cedarville's success: when he posts at least two stolen bases the team is 2-1 (and 1-3 when he doesn't).

Baldwin wasn't the only one making solid contact as two players wound up with at least one hit. One of them was Xavier Pauling, who went 1-for-2 with one stolen base and one RBI. Another was Jacob Lide, who scored a run and stole two bases.

Cedarville's record is now 3-4. As for Fairbanks, they now have a losing record of 4-5.

Looking ahead, Cedarville will be playing in front of their home fans against East Clinton at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Fairbanks, they will head out to face off against Riverside at 11:00 a.m. on Saturday.
